You should be able to send a request from the CRD Request Generator in order for the SMART app to launch by clicking the `Patient Select:` button to pre-populate the inputs. Choose a `Device, Service, or Medication Request` from the drop-down for one of the patients, then click anywhere in the row corresponding to the patient for whom you selected a `Device, Service, or Medication Request`. The data will be prefetched and you can send the request by pressing the `Submit` button. You should get a CDS Hooks Card back. Click the SMART link button for `Order Form` and you should see a login screen. Login with whatever user you've registered, and the SMART App should proceed to launch. -## Building Releases - -Official releases are built automatically, but you may test the process or roll your own similar to the following: - - docker build -t hspc/davinci-dtr:latest . - -To run dev (https=false, port=3005, proxy=http://localhost:8090): - - docker run -it --name davinci-dtr -p 3005:3005 --rm hspc/davinci-dtr:latest - -To run production (https=true, port=3005, proxy=https://davinci-crd.logicahealth.org): - - docker run -e VERSION='Prod' -it --name davinci-dtr -p 3005:3005 --rm hspc/davinci-dtr:latest - -To run configurable template: - - docker run -e VERSION='Template' -e PROXY_TARGET='http:\/\/localhost:8090' -e SERVER_PORT='3005' -e SERVER_HTTPS='false' -it --name davinci-dtr -p 3005:3005 --rm hspc/davinci-dtr:latest - -The configurable template will use the environment variables passed to the docker run command to replace the `PROXY_TARGET`, `SERVER_PORT`, and `SERVER_HTTPS` values in the webpack configuration file. - # Other Documentation [Using ValueSets in DTR Rules](./using-valuesets-in-rules.md)
